The ECNL National Event in Houston kicks off on Saturday. This is the fourth event of the club season, and a number of the national championship favorites are in action from the U18/19 age group all the way down to the U15 age group. 

This is also the last event of the season that includes U18/19 teams. With the remarkable rise in players graduating from high school early and enrolling during the spring at the college level, the change in the dynamic of the U18/19 teams from the fall to the spring is noteworthy. This event is the last time for some of those 2022 graduates to get quality game film during this club season before the playoffs. 

The other age groups showcase plenty of exciting players including a number of the players recently named to the U.S. U17 Women’s National Team Player Pool. All three days will feature some of the best club soccer at each age group.

U18/19 

The event kicks off with a hot start on Saturday as the No. 1 team in the Champions League standings, Solar (10-0-0), takes on the No. 4 team in the Champions League standings, Crossfire United (4-0), at 1:50 pm. Crossfire United has only conceded one goal through the early stage of the season, which will certainly be tested against the potent Solar attack that has already eclipsed 100 goals scored for the season. Solar also takes on Michigan Hawks and Tennessee SC during the three-day event. Crossfire United faces Indiana Fire and Sting Dallas Black. 

U17 

Real Colorado National against Solar SC on the opening day feels like the dessert being served before the appetizer, but the fixture is probably good enough to deliver all three courses. Real Colorado is 5-0 in conference play and has a roster full of youth national team talent. Solar SC dropped out of the top spot in the Champions League standings following a draw against Classics Elite, but responded with a dominant performance during the ECNL event in Florida.

FC Dallas against United Futbol Academy is nothing to look over either from the opening day. FC Dallas went 2-1 during the ECNL event in Florida last month, which included the first loss of the season for the team - an 0-1 result to Richmond United. Back in Texas, FC Dallas will be hoping for a 3-0 weekend. United Futbol Academy is a tough opening test. The Georgia club has only lost two games this season - both to Concorde Fire Platinum. UFA is playing good soccer right now, and could be prime for a big weekend in Texas with easily the most difficult schedule of any team in Houston. UFA has games against FC Dallas, Solar, and Real Colorado National during the three-day event. Depth and defense will be tested with that type of schedule. 

Minnesota Thunder opens up the event against DKSC. Thunder are still in the early stages of the season, and looking to make a mark at this event. With games against DKSC, Crossfire United, and Solar, the squad will definitely be tested. 

U16 

This might feel like Groundhog Day, but it’s not. Real Colorado National is facing off against Solar SC in the U16 age group, and it’s another must-see game. While some could argue that Solar SC is the favorite in the U17 matchup, most would argue that Real Colorado National is the favorite in the U16 age group. Real Colorado National has a perfect record in ECNL games this season - including games during National Events. The team only got stronger recently with the addition of U.S. U17 Women’s National Team Player Pool member Jasmine Aikey to the roster. Real Colorado had nine players called into the U17 WNT and there are a few more on the roster who probably should be there too - this roster is loaded. The game against Solar will be a good test. Real Colorado National also faces FC Dallas and GSA during the three-day event in Houston. 

SLSG-Navy is another team to watch in the U16 age group. They went 0-3 during the last event in Florida. They will be hoping to bounce back in Houston with games against FC Dallas, Solar, and Portland Thorns. 

U15 

It’s been a long time since Colorado Rapids played an ECNL game, but the team leading the way in the Champions League standings in the U15 age group hits the field on Saturday with a goal against Sting Dallas Black. Rapids also take on Tampa Bay United Rowdies and Solar SC during the three-day event.
